Why a US$70 day trip to Johor is now Singaporeans’ favourite leisure hack

Every month, Rachel Tan, a 53-year-old Singaporean tutor, boards a bus across the 1km (0.6 mile) causeway for a day trip to Malaysia’s Johor state, where she stocks up on groceries and treats herself to lunch and a film. Thanks to streamlined immigration procedures, she rarely needs to present her passport, using a QR code to pass the checkpoint before catching a complimentary shuttle bus that whisks her to R&F Mall. The entire day out, including shopping, typically costs her about 300 ringgit...
